No, there is no direct train from Henley-on-Thames to Kettering. However, there are services departing from Henley-on-Thames and arriving at Kettering via Twyford, Paddington and London St Pancras Intl.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 16m.
The distance between Henley-on-Thames and Kettering is 110 miles. The road distance is 74.8 miles.
